The Crucial Role of Journalism in Modern Society
Journalism has long been considered a ‘witness to history,’ playing a vital role in providing information, overseeing power, shaping public opinion, and driving societal development. In today’s era of information explosion, this role is more crucial than ever. Journalism helps the public access current events, from major international news to pressing social issues. The ability of journalism to reflect truthfully, objectively, and promptly is key to providing the public with a comprehensive view and making informed decisions.
Challenges Facing Journalism in the Digital Age
However, journalism today faces unprecedented challenges. The explosion of the internet and social media has created a massive ‘information jungle,’ making information verification more difficult. Fake news, misinformation, and propaganda campaigns are spreading at an alarming rate, seriously threatening the credibility and role of journalism. In addition, fierce competition in the media market is also a significant challenge for news organizations.
The development of AI also raises questions about the future of journalism. AI can assist in writing news, analyzing data, but can it completely replace human critical thinking, questioning ability, and subtle perception?
The Future of Journalism: Sustainable Development and Adaptation
To survive and thrive in this challenging context, journalism needs to adapt and innovate. Improving content quality, focusing on accuracy and objectivity, and diversifying information delivery methods are crucial factors. Journalism needs to invest in technology, develop sustainable business models, and build trusted relationships with readers. Transparency and accountability are also essential for journalism to maintain credibility and public trust.
The combination of traditional and online journalism will be an inevitable trend in the future. Journalism needs to leverage the power of the internet and social media to reach a wider audience, but it also needs to be cautious to avoid the dangers of misinformation and manipulation of public opinion.
In short, journalism plays a vital role in modern society. To overcome challenges and continue fulfilling its role, journalism must innovate, adapt, and always prioritize the public interest.
